This is not a laboratory position.
Position Purpose:
Responsible for reviewing and approving hazardous and non-hazardous material for disposal in accordance with site capabilities, approved permits, and appropriate regulatory requirements. Determines acceptability or rejection of chemical components of materials utilizing analytical data, MSDS’s, and facility information. Ensures that the approval process is in proper compliance with company and regulatory policies and procedures.
Primary Duties /Responsibilities:
Tracks individual profiles to ensure that approvals are completed in a reasonable amount of time to meet scheduled incineration. Assigns pricing codes to waste streams. Assigns parameters in laboratory testing of individual samples to verify material. Provide constructive input on existing and/or proposed policies, regulations, and other pertinent changes to expedite the approval process at the facility. Completes the approvals on a variety of materials. Assists in the technical training for facility. Other duties as assigned.
